As the world continues to evolve, so do the ways in which people connect with their faith and their church community. With the advent of technology, many churches around the world are now using various platforms to stream their services online. This allows people to participate in worship and fellowship from the comfort of their own home, and it can also be a great option for those who live in areas where there is not a church nearby or for those who are traveling and want to stay connected to their home church.
There are many different ways that churches are using technology to stream their services. Some churches use platforms like Facebook Live or YouTube to stream their services in real-time, while others use pre-recorded services that can be watched at any time. Some churches even offer a combination of both, with a live stream of their main service and a selection of pre-recorded content that can be accessed at any time.
One of the main benefits of streaming church online is that it allows people to participate in worship and fellowship from the comfort of their own home. This can be especially beneficial for those who are unable to physically attend church due to illness, disability, or other circumstances. It can also be a great option for those who live in areas where there is not a church nearby, or for those who are traveling and want to stay connected to their home church.
However, it is important for those who are streaming church services to also find ways to stay connected to their church community. This can include participating in online discussions and small groups, volunteering for church-related projects and events, and staying in touch with church leadership and other members.
